Jennifer wants to visit 4 different cities A,B,C and D on her vacation. If she will visit them one at a time, and completly random, what is thr probabitly that she will visit them in the exact order ABCD or DCBA?​

Answers

Answer: The probability that she will visit them in the exact order ABCD or DCBA =  [tex]\dfrac{1}{12}[/tex]

Step-by-step explanation:

Given: Jennifer wants to visit 4 different cities A,B,C and D on her vacation.

If she visits in an order , total such orders will be [tex]4![/tex] = 4 x 2 x 3 x 1 =24.

Since probability = [tex]\dfrac{\text{Favourable outcomes}}{\text{total outcomes}}[/tex]

In this case favorable outcomes ( ABCD ,  DCBA)=  2

Total outcomes = 24

Required probability = [tex]\dfrac{2}{24}=\dfrac{1}{12}[/tex]

Hence, the probability that she will visit them in the exact order ABCD or DCBA =  [tex]\dfrac{1}{12}[/tex]

Find the area of the triangle. Round the answer to the nearest tenth. Triangle is SSA. a= 3.7 b= 3.7 β= 70° ----- A.4.4 square units B.5.2 square units C.6.8 square units D.8.8 square units

Answers

Answer:

  A.  4.40 square units

Step-by-step explanation:

The triangle is isosceles with base angles of 70°. The a.pex angle will be ...

  180° -2(70°) = 40°

The area of a triangle can be computed from two sides and the angle between them as ...

  A = (1/2)ab·sin(γ)

  A = (1/2)(3.7)(3.7)sin(40°) ≈ 4.40 . . .  square units

A metal cube
of
side 4.4cm was melted
and the molten material used to make a Sphere
Find to 3 significant figures the radius of
the
sphere [take It - 22/7]​.

Answers

Answer: 2.73 cm

Step-by-step explanation:

Given that :

Side (a) of cube = 4.4cm

Volume of a cube (V) = a^3

V = 4.4^3

V = 85.184cm^3

Therefore, volume of the sphere made = 85.184cm^3

Volume of sphere = 4/3 πr^3

Where r = radius

85.184 = (4/3)*(22/7)*r^3

85.184 = (88/21)*r^3

85.184 = 4.1905 * r^3

r^3 = 85.184 / 4.1905

r^3 = 20.327884

Take the cube root of both sides

r = 2.73 cm

Surface Area of Triangular Prism
Instructions: Find the surface area of each figure. Round your answers to the nearest tenth, if necessary.

PLEASE HELP ME!!!

Answers

Answer: 247 square cm

===================================================

Explanation:

Any triangle prism is composed of 2 parallel triangular faces (base faces), along with 3 rectangular lateral faces.

The bottom triangle face has a base of 10 cm and a height of 4 cm. The area is 0.5*base*height = 0.5*10*4 = 20 square cm. Two of these triangles combine to an area of 2*20 = 40 square cm. We'll use this later.

The lateral surface area of any prism can be found by multiplying the perimeter of the base by the height of the prism. The base triangle has side lengths 5, 8 and 10. The perimeter is 5+8+10 = 23. So the lateral surface area is (perimeter)*(height) = 23*9 = 207

Add this to the total base area we got earlier and the answer is 40+207 = 247. The units are in square cm, which we can write as cm^2.

John is a trail runner who decides to take a day off work to run up and down a local mountain. He runs uphill at an average speed of 5 miles per hour and returns along the same route at an average speed of 7 miles per hour. Of the following, which is the closest to his average speed, in miles per hour, for the trip up and down the mountain?
(A) 5.5
(B) 5.8
(C) 6.0
(D) 6.3
(E) 6.5

Answers

Answer:

Average speed

= 5 5/6 mph , or

= 5.83 mph (to 2 decimals)

Step-by-step explanation:

Average speed is total distance divided by the total time it takes to cover the given distance.

Since uphill = 5 mph, and downhill = 7 mph, we know the average speed is between 5 and 7 mph.

Let

x = distance uphill, and also distance downhill.

Total distance = 2x miles

Total time = x/5 + x/7 hours  = 12x/35 hours

Average speed

= total distance/total time

= 2x / (12x/35) mph

= 70x / 12x

= 5 5/6 mph

= 5.83 mph (to 2 decimals)

a^2 + b^2 + c^2 = 2(a − b − c) − 3. (1) Calculate the value of 2a − 3b + 4c.

Answers

Answer:

[tex]2a - 3b + 4c = 1[/tex]

Step-by-step explanation:

Given

[tex]a^2 + b^2 + c^2 = 2(a - b - c) - 3[/tex]

Required

Determine [tex]2a - 3b + 4c[/tex]

[tex]a^2 + b^2 + c^2 = 2(a - b - c) - 3[/tex]

Open bracket

[tex]a^2 + b^2 + c^2 = 2a - 2b - 2c - 3[/tex]

Equate the equation to 0

[tex]a^2 + b^2 + c^2 - 2a + 2b + 2c + 3 = 0[/tex]

Express 3 as 1 + 1 + 1

[tex]a^2 + b^2 + c^2 - 2a + 2b + 2c + 1 + 1 + 1 = 0[/tex]

Collect like terms

[tex]a^2 - 2a + 1 + b^2 + 2b + 1 + c^2 + 2c + 1 = 0[/tex]

Group each terms

[tex](a^2 - 2a + 1) + (b^2 + 2b + 1) + (c^2 + 2c + 1) = 0[/tex]

Factorize (starting with the first bracket)

[tex](a^2 - a -a + 1) + (b^2 + 2b + 1) + (c^2 + 2c + 1) = 0[/tex]

[tex](a(a - 1) -1(a - 1)) + (b^2 + 2b + 1) + (c^2 + 2c + 1) = 0[/tex]

[tex]((a - 1) (a - 1)) + (b^2 + 2b + 1) + (c^2 + 2c + 1) = 0[/tex]

[tex]((a - 1)^2) + (b^2 + 2b + 1) + (c^2 + 2c + 1) = 0[/tex]

[tex]((a - 1)^2) + (b^2 + b+b + 1) + (c^2 + 2c + 1) = 0[/tex]

[tex]((a - 1)^2) + (b(b + 1)+1(b + 1)) + (c^2 + 2c + 1) = 0[/tex]

[tex]((a - 1)^2) + ((b + 1)(b + 1)) + (c^2 + 2c + 1) = 0[/tex]

[tex]((a - 1)^2) + ((b + 1)^2) + (c^2 + 2c + 1) = 0[/tex]

[tex]((a - 1)^2) + ((b + 1)^2) + (c^2 + c+c + 1) = 0[/tex]

[tex]((a - 1)^2) + ((b + 1)^2) + (c(c + 1)+1(c + 1)) = 0[/tex]

[tex]((a - 1)^2) + ((b + 1)^2) + ((c + 1)(c + 1)) = 0[/tex]

[tex]((a - 1)^2) + ((b + 1)^2) + ((c + 1)^2) = 0[/tex]

Express 0 as 0 + 0 + 0

[tex](a - 1)^2 + (b + 1)^2 + (c + 1)^2 = 0 + 0+ 0[/tex]

By comparison

[tex](a - 1)^2 = 0[/tex]

[tex](b + 1)^2 = 0[/tex]

[tex](c + 1)^2 = 0[/tex]

Solving for [tex](a - 1)^2 = 0[/tex]

Take square root of both sides

[tex]a - 1 = 0[/tex]

Add 1 to both sides

[tex]a - 1 + 1 = 0 + 1[/tex]

[tex]a = 1[/tex]

Solving for [tex](b + 1)^2 = 0[/tex]

Take square root of both sides

[tex]b + 1 = 0[/tex]

Subtract 1 from both sides

[tex]b + 1 - 1 = 0 - 1[/tex]

[tex]b = -1[/tex]

Solving for [tex](c + 1)^2 = 0[/tex]

Take square root of both sides

[tex]c + 1 = 0[/tex]

Subtract 1 from both sides

[tex]c + 1 - 1 = 0 - 1[/tex]

[tex]c = -1[/tex]

Substitute the values of a, b and c in [tex]2a - 3b + 4c[/tex]

[tex]2a - 3b + 4c = 2(1) - 3(-1) + 4(-1)[/tex]

[tex]2a - 3b + 4c = 2 +3 -4[/tex]

[tex]2a - 3b + 4c = 1[/tex]

1. Use the rules of divisibility to check which of the following
numbers are multiples of (are divisible by) 2,3,4,5,6, 8, 9 and 10
a) 552
b) 315
c) 620
d) 426​

Answers

a) 552 is a multiple of 2, 3, 4, 6 and 8
b) 315 is a multiple of 3, 5 and 9
c) 620 is a multiple of 2, 4, 5 and 10
d) 426 is a multiple of 2 and 3

Rules include:
Even numbers are divisible by 2.
If the sum of a number’s digits are divisible by 3, the number is divisible by 3.
Any number ending in 5 or 0 is divisible by 5.
Any number divisible by both 2 and 3 is divisible by 6.
If the sum of a number’s digits are divisible by 9, the number is divisible by 9.
If a number ends in 0, it is divisible by 10.
